How to Obtain a Labour Market Opinion (LMO)

Posted in Labour Market Impact Assessment LMIA

When an employer in Canada wants to hire a foreign worker, they must first get approval from Human Resources and Skills Development Canada (HRSDC)/Service Canada. This approval will come in the form of a positive labour market opinion. The foreign worker will need to include this opinion with their application for a work permit.

Before you can offer a job to a foreign worker, you, as the employer must submit this application and obtain the proper authorization to do so. This is not something that is typically handled by the intended foreign worker as you will be required to demonstrate aspects of your business as well as your efforts made on first seeking Canadian citizens or permanent resident to first fill the position before looking to foreign workers to fill the gap.

As an employer attempting to hire a foreign worker, you will first need to make sure that the position you are attempting to fill is a position that you cannot first fill by employing a readily available Canadian permanent resident or citizen. In order to demonstrate this you will need to be recruitment efforts.

This means that you will first have to attempt to find workers readily available in Canada who are able to fill the position. In order to do this, you will need to advertise for the position and go through the regular hiring process. Who knows, maybe a Canadian is available and you do not need to hire.

After your recruitment efforts; such as news postings, online job postings, reviewing resumes and interviewing appropriate candidates – after all this, and you still cannot find someone suitable, than you may qualify for a positive Labour Market Opinion – should you find a foreign worker who you feel would be a good fit for the intended occupation.

Once you have made sufficient and qualifying recruitment efforts and have found a suitable foreign worker, you will need to demonstrate these efforts to HRSDC/Service Canada in your application for a labour market opinion. You will also need to demonstrate how and why the foreign worker is a more suitable fit than the readily available Canadians who had applied.

The Temporary Foreign Worker Unit, a division of HRSDC, whose primary purpose is to process applications such as the labour market opinion, will make a decision on your matter. They will issue you either a positive or negative labour market opinion.

Depending on the nature of work, you will need to submit different application types with different criteria. They are also dependent on the National Occupational Classification matrix as well as the intended duties of the intended foreign worker.

The current application types are:

  • Agricultural Workers
  • Live-in Caregivers
  • Lower-skilled Occupations
  • Higher-skilled Occupations
